Couple of questions

1.How do you get the sky in pics really blue ?

2.How do you get the black borders round your pics ?

Thats is all cheers

There are a number of ways,
1:
You can use a polarizer, exposing for the sky will also help.
In photoshop CTRL 'U' change the colour chanel to blue and adjust the saturation.
It's worth reading about exposure to understand how your sensor tries to expose a scene.
2:
Photoshop, personally i'd make the canvas bigger, i think from memory it's in edit-canvas size. By making the canvas bigger you'll get your black border. (i think you can pick the colour from memory)

I fancied the 50mm originally but eventually changed my mind and opted for the 35mm, as i thought it would be more of a useful/usable focal length, it was Ł199 from Jacobs Digital in Newcastle.

Argos have the Nikon 50mm f1.8 lens for Ł87.99 but unfortunately its been out of stock for a while All the reviews of the 50mm lens say that for joe public its not worth the extra expense for the faster f1.4 lens and that they produce their best images when stopped down to around f4-f8
